Application

Technical Notes:
1. A ligand for as ymmetric conjugate addition of dialkyI zinc reagents to activated olefins .
2.L igand used in the iridium-c atalyzed, enantios elective addition of nucleophiles to achiral
allylic esters
3.As ymmetric hydrogenation.
4.Ir-catalyzed regio- and enantioselective F riedel-Crafts allylic alkylation of indoles .
6.As ymmetric hydrovinylation.
6.Used in 1,3-dipolar cycloaddition reactions of azomethine ylides and alkenes," a and
7.Rh-catalyzed 5+2 cycloaddition of alkyne -vinyl-c yclopropanes .
P alladium-catalyzed enantios elective de- epimerization in catalytic asymmetric allylic alkylation. 8. P alladium-catalyzed enantios elective diamination of alkyl dienes .
